CHARGING PROCEDURE
NOTE: Before using the tool, read the instruction
book carefully.
1. CHARGING YOUR BATTERY PACK
The battery charger supplied is matched to the Li-ion
battery installed in the machine. Do not use another
battery charger.
The Li-ion battery is protected against deep discharging.
When the battery is empty, the machine is switched off by
means of a protective circuit: The tool no longer rotates.
In a warm environment or after heavy use, the battery
pack may become too hot to permit charging. Allow time
for the battery to cool down before recharging.
2. BEFORE USING YOUR CORDLESS TOOL
Your battery pack is UNCHARGED and you must charge
once before use.
3. HOW TO CHARGE YOUR BATTERY PACK (See
Fig. A, B)
Connect the battery charger to the power supply.
Slide the battery pack into the charger to make the
connections. The light (1) will become green and flash to
show charging has started.
After charging, the light will not flash and stay green,
which means the battery is full, and charging is completed.
CHARGING INDICATOR
This charger is designed to detect some problems that can
arise with battery packs. Indicator lights indicate problems
(see table below). If this occurs, insert a new battery
pack to determine if the charger is OK. If the new battery
charges correctly, then the original pack is defective and
should be returned to a service center or recycling service
